WebAug 22, 2016 · Ions in 0.2 moles = 0.2 x 6.022 x 10 23 = 1.2044 x 10 23 ions. Charge on each ion = 3 x 1.602 x 10 -19 = 4.806 x 10 -19 coulombs. So, charge of 19g of PO 4 3- ions = 1.2044 x 10 23 x 4.806 x 10 -19 coulombs = 5.78 x 10 4 Coulombs .
